WebBy definition, albedo is what percentage of photons will reflect. Fresh snow has an albedo of 0.9 and will reflect 90% of incoming photons, while fresh asphalt has an albedo of 0.04 and will reflect just 4% of incoming photons.

Meteorologists identify albedo on a scale of 0 to 1. A value of 0 means the surface absorbs all incoming energy, while a value of 1 means a surface reflects all incoming energy.
